(a) Station No. <-> IP information setting system (conversion method)
There are four kinds of station No. <-> IP information setting system as shown below.
Conversion method
Automatic response system
IP address calculation system
Table exchange system
Combination use system
For details of each conversion method, refer to Page 39, Section 3.5.2.
(b) Net mask pattern
Specify the mask value based on the guidelines given below. This pattern is used in a logical sum with the own
station's IP address when calculating the IP address of the external device using the IP address computation
system.
• When setting the sub-net mask, specify the target settings of the IP address class, network address, and
sub-net address so that all bits are "1" in the mask pattern. The mask pattern is specified with a
decimal/hexadecimal value obtained by dividing the 32-bit mask value into 8-bit segments.
• When the sub-net mask is not specified, the mask pattern specification is not necessary. When the mask
pattern is not specified, the following mask value is used as the mask pattern according to the own station
IP Address class.
